Chapter 205: The Sea God Trident

Faced with Bo Saixi's question, Yang Tianyue took a long moment before responding: "Senior, I grew up without any contact with the Clear Sky Clan. I know little about the past grievances between my clan and the Clear Sky Clan, nor do I care to. I am simply a member of the Yang family and the Sky Path Academy, focusing on strengthening my family and academy without any intention of rekindling ties with the Clear Sky Clan."

Bo Saixi nodded, then turned to Yang Potian. "And what of you, Yang Potian? What is your perspective on the Clear Sky Clan and Tang Chen?"

For Bo Saixi, despite Yang Tianyue being the designated successor of the Sea God, it was clear that Yang Potian was the core of the group, the leader they all looked to. His stance was perhaps what Bo Saixi valued most.

Yang Potian thought carefully before he spoke. "I was not directly involved in the Clear Sky Clan conflict, as I was in Tian Dou City at the time. However, I understand that without the Clear Sky Clan, our Yang family might not have advanced as far as it has. But during the battle with the Clear Sky Clan, our family suffered heavy losses, and in the end, we were discarded by them."

"As things stand, it's best that each of us goes our own way. The Yang family has retreated far from Tian Dou City and now resides in the Almore Mountains, thousands of kilometers away. We have no intention of ever getting involved with the Clear Sky Clan again."

Bo Saixi sighed and gently shook her head. "The fault doesn't lie solely with the Clear Sky Clan. They, too, were victims. Have you ever thought about reconciling?"

Yang Potian's response was direct. "With respect, Senior, what do you mean by 'reconcile'? Do you mean returning to being one of the Clear Sky Clan's vassals? I believe that, as the Yang family now has a Sea God successor, we will not lower ourselves to become the subordinate family of any force. That would go against the Sea God's honor and dignity."

An awkward silence followed, with both Bo Saixi and Yang Potian uncertain how to proceed. Finally, Bo Saixi sighed again. "Tang Chen and I were once old friends. In the future, I hope you won't come into conflict with the Clear Sky Clan or with Tang Chen."

Yang Potian smiled politely. "Please don't worry, Senior. My clan has retreated from worldly conflicts and has no reason to provoke other forces."

Yang Potian's mind whirred as he carefully weighed Bo Saixi's words. He couldn't help but think, So many years later, and Bo Saixi still harbors feelings for Tang Chen? Could she be hoping to protect the Clear Sky Clan for him? And if that's the case, perhaps the real power Qian Daoliu fears isn't Tang Chen, but Bo Saixi.

Bo Saixi resumed her calm, detached expression. "Yang Tianyue, the seventh trial of your Sea God test is to lift the Sea God Trident. Should you succeed, all three of you will pass the seventh trial. If you fail, however, you'll face the consequences. I cannot tell you what the result might be."

With that, the three turned their attention to the tall staff-like object embedded in the floor at the center of the hall. This was the famed Sea God Trident, though only the staff's body was visible, with its prongs buried in the stone floor.

Yang Tianyue stepped forward, trying every technique she could think of to pull the trident from the floor. However, as a weapon spirit master, her abilities were all focused on enhancing her attack power. Even when she poured her soul power into it, the Sea God Trident did not budge.

Even with Ye Lingling assisting, the trident didn't move an inch. Yang Potian stood to the side, watching without offering help. He wanted to let his sister face this challenge on her own, feeling that she needed a humbling experience. If she truly managed to wield the Sea God Trident and her power grew, he feared her arrogance might spiral out of control.

Bo Saixi, observing silently, seemed unsurprised. She knew that lifting the Sea God Trident was no simple task. Even she found it nearly impossible to lift it herself, as the trident weighed over 108,000 jin—a feat achievable only with divine strength.

After struggling for some time, Yang Tianyue turned to Yang Potian with a hint of frustration. "Brother, won't you at least try with me? With the three of us working together, we might be able to lift it."

Yang Potian shook his head. "Tianyue, this is your test, not mine. If I help, it defeats the purpose of your trial. I've given you two powerful strength-enhancing soul bones, but you haven't fully grasped how to use them. Also, remember the techniques I taught you—if you can master them, lifting the trident should be within your reach."

Yang Potian was referring to techniques like Controlling Crane, Capturing Dragon, and Mysterious Jade Hand. In the original story, Tang San had lifted the trident with Ning Rongrong's help and through exhausting effort. Yang Tianyue's physical strength and soul power far surpassed Tang San's, especially with her soul bones.

Yang Tianyue's talent was undeniable, and with her brother's reminder, she regained her focus, channeling her power to its utmost limits. Her right arm glowed a vibrant green while her left arm shimmered in gold, her hands darkening to a jade-like green as she activated her attached Ground Demon Bear soul bone.

Meanwhile, Ye Lingling opted not to pull with her, instead summoning her Nine-Hearted Begonia in full power, filling the area with a healing light and restoring Yang Tianyue as she strained herself.

Channeling her strength to its peak, Yang Tianyue finally managed to shift the trident ever so slightly, though it remained stuck in place.

Seeing this, Yang Potian offered one final reminder. "Don't forget about your Sea God Affinity and the Vast Sea Cosmic Shroud. The Sea God Trident is a divine weapon, so the higher your affinity, the closer you'll be to it."

At his words, Yang Tianyue's brow emitted a faint blue glow as the Vast Sea Cosmic Shroud emerged from her forehead. The shroud began to resonate with both Yang Tianyue and the trident, its blue light intensifying, expanding until it perfectly matched the hollow space within the trident's head.

With her strength and soul power at their limit, her body pushed to its breaking point, Yang Tianyue gave one final pull—and with a flash of blue light, the Sea God Trident rose from the ground, flooding the hall with divine radiance. The power that surged from it was primordial and unmatched, illuminating Sea God Island and casting light far across the ocean.

Yang Tianyue, gripping the trident tightly, was bathed in a golden glow, a mark of her recognition by the trident. As she held it, the weapon's weight seemed to fade, becoming no heavier than a normal object.

With the Sea God Trident successfully lifted, Yang Tianyue had completed the seventh trial of the Sea God test.

In Yang Potian's mind, a voice echoed: "Crimson Level Test Seventh Trial complete. Support the Sea God's successor in lifting the Sea God Trident. All soul ring ages increased by 5,000 years."

As for Yang Tianyue, her Sea God Affinity increased by another 20%, reaching 90%, a reward for her mastery of divine connection. Additionally, she gained the right to wield the Sea God Trident.

Ye Lingling's seventh trial, too, was now fully complete. Her reward included a level increase and a 500-year boost to her soul ring ages. For completing all seven of her crimson trials, she received an additional level increase, another 5,000 years to her soul rings, and a God-given soul ring.

Now, only Yang Tianyue's tests remained. The others had completed their trials, and their time on Sea God Island was nearing its end. As Bo Saixi looked on with an unusual expression, she seemed stunned that Yang Tianyue had indeed managed to lift the Sea God Trident. Even with Sea Dragon Douluo's assistance, it was a nearly impossible feat.

Seeing her brother's confidence in navigating the trial, Yang Tianyue couldn't help but boast a little. "Brother, I did it! I can use the Sea God Trident now, and it only weighs 108 jin in my hand. Now that I have a divine weapon, no one in the world will be able to beat me!"

Yang Potian chuckled at her enthusiasm, amused by her confidence. He knew that without Ye Lingling's constant healing, Yang Tianyue would have been injured by the trident's weight long before now.

Bo Saixi also congratulated her. "Well done, Yang Tianyue. You have passed the seventh Sea God trial. Now comes the eighth. I urge you to give it your all."

Yang Potian already knew the content of Yang Tianyue's eighth trial: to slay the Deep Sea Demon Whale King, acquire all its bones, and reach level 99 within twenty years. He shook his head, considering the enormity of the task. The Deep Sea Demon Whale King's strength was likely close to that of Bo Saixi herself, and reaching level 99 as a single-soul wielder was no small feat.

Yang Tianyue's face grew serious as she read the trial's requirements. Clearly, she was beginning to grasp the difficulty ahead.

The three followed Bo Saixi out of the temple, Yang Potian suddenly had an idea and asked, "Senior, would it be possible for Tianyue to cultivate within the Sea God Temple?"

Bo Saixi hesitated briefly but then nodded. "Yes, as the Sea God's successor, she may cultivate here."

"Senior, could I speak to you privately for a moment?"

Bo Saixi considered his request. "Very well."

After Yang Tianyue and Ye Lingling had been dismissed, Bo Saixi turned to him. "What is it that you need to discuss with me privately?"

Yang Potian smiled slightly. "Senior, would you be willing to help Tianyue complete the final two trials?"

Bo Saixi's expression shifted. "You know the nature of these trials. What makes you think I would agree to assist her?"

Yang Potian shook his head. "I understand what it would entail, but of course, I would offer you something in return."

Bo Saixi's face held a trace of disdain. "I am the High Priestess of Sea God Island. There is very little that I need in this world, so I doubt you have anything of value to offer me."

Yang Potian replied evenly, "What if it were information about Tang Chen? I could arrange for you to meet him."

Bo Saixi's eyes widened. "You know where Tang Chen is? Where is he?"

"Senior, I must apologize—I came across this information by chance. Tang Chen is trapped, and without my help, he may never escape."

After a lengthy pause, Bo Saixi said, "If you can ensure Tang Chen's safety, I will help Yang Tianyue."

Yang Potian replied, "I can help restore his sanity, but I cannot guarantee his life."

Bo Saixi clenched her teeth. "Fine, I agree. Now, where is he?"

Yang Potian gave her no answer, instead quietly taking his leave. Watching him go, Bo Saixi's face showed a rare flicker of surprise.
